The prices of several food commodities in West Sumatra today were observed to decrease compared to yesterday.

According to data from the National Food Agency (Bapanas) food price panel on Wednesday (24/9/2025) at 15:06 WIB, out of 24 commodities, 6 commodities increased and 18 commodities decreased.

Commodities with increased prices include shallots, mackerel, packaged cooking oil, SPHP rice, and corn at the farmer level.

Meanwhile, prices of several commodities such as pure beef, medium rice, garlic bulb, premium rice, and consumption salt decreased compared to yesterday''s prices.

Imported dried soybean seeds saw the highest jump of Rp99 (0.92%) to Rp10,859 per kg. Meanwhile, milkfish prices fell the most by Rp5,000 (11.11%) to Rp40,000 per kg.

Below is the complete list of 24 food commodity prices in West Sumatra according to Bapanas on September 24, 2025, at 15:06 WIB.

  1. Pure Beef: Rp142,961 per kg (down 0.48%)
  2. Fresh Buffalo Meat (Local): Rp142,727 per kg (down 0.42%)
  3. Curly Red Chili: Rp81,091 per kg (down 1.88%)
  4. Large Red Chili: Rp69,923 per kg (down 1.17%)
  5. Mackerel: Rp55,854 per kg (up 0.1%)
  6. Red Bird''s Eye Chili: Rp55,357 per kg (down 0.51%)
  7. Skipjack Tuna: Rp42,574 per kg (down 0.66%)
  8. Milkfish: Rp40,000 per kg (down 11.11%)
  9. Broiler Chicken Meat: Rp37,248 per kg (down 0.37%)
  10. Garlic Bulb: Rp34,227 per kg (down 1.34%)
  11. Shallots: Rp32,308 per kg (up 0.13%)
  12. Broiler Chicken Eggs: Rp29,111 per kg (down 0.01%)
  13. Packaged Cooking Oil: Rp19,831 per liter (up 0.7%)
  14. Consumption Sugar: Rp18,346 per kg (down 0.03%)
  15. Minyakita (Subsidized Cooking Oil): Rp17,323 per liter (down 0.17%)
  16. Premium Rice: Rp16,815 per kg (down 0.05%)
  17. Bulk Cooking Oil: Rp15,904 per liter (down 0.16%)
  18. Consumption Salt: Rp15,333 per kg (down 0.56%)
  19. Medium Rice: Rp14,371 per kg (down 0.33%)
  20. Packaged Wheat Flour: Rp13,294 per kg (down 0.04%)
  21. SPHP Rice: Rp12,928 per kg (up 0.02%)
  22. Dried Soybean Seeds (Imported): Rp10,859 per kg (up 0.92%)
  23. Bulk Wheat Flour: Rp9,081 per kg (down 1.71%)
  24. Corn at Farmer Level: Rp6,564 per kg (up 0.11%)
